
Live® daily disposable
Are you looking for daily contact lenses that offer comfort, health, convenience and affordability? Live® daily disposable are silicone hydrogel 1-day contact lenses designed to meet these needs—enabling you to live life your way.
The features you'll love

Live® for comfort—made using AquaGen® Technology, the sustained high water content in these silicone hydrogel 1-day contact lenses ensures excellent all-day comfort.

Live® for health—Live® daily disposable silicone hydrogel 1-day contact lenses allows 100% of the oxygen to reach your eyes, transmitting more than the recommended amount of oxygen2 across the whole lens surface, which helps keep your eyes in good health.

Live® daily disposable contact lenses help protect your eyes by blocking harmful UV radiation.*

Live® for convenience—1-day contact lenses offer you a range of benefits such as fresh new lenses every day and no need for lens cases or care solutions.

Live® for affordability†—a silicone hydrogel 1-day contact lens at the price of a hydrogel 1-day.
